Manjaro – Wayland Nvidia Login Loop
Nach der Manjaro Installation Version 22.1.3 mit Plasma und Grafik-Plattform Wayland mit den proprietären Nvidia Treibern wurde es direkt spannend: Ein Login ins System war nicht möglich. Das System bootete bis zur Benutzerabfrage und nach Eingabe der Daten wurde der Bildschirm kurz schwarz und landete wieder bei der Benutzerabfrage. Ein Login via TTY war jedoch möglich. Aus der TTY konnte ebenfalls „startx“ ausgeführt werden. Nach einiger Recherche konnte dann aber eine Lösung gefunden werden: Im Grub Bootloader (Multi-Boot System) fehlte der Parameter „nvidia_drm.modeset=1“.
Warum dieser bei der Installation nicht mit angepasst wird ist mir ein Rätsel. Die Lösung für das Problem lautet jedoch wie folgt:
|
1 |
sudo nano /etc/default/grub |
Den Parameter „GRUB_CMDLINE_LINUX_DEFAULT“ suchen und am Ende (innerhalb der Anführungszeichen) den Wert
|
1 |
nvidia_drm.modeset=1 |
ergänzen. Anschließend mit Strg+O und Strg+X speichern und schließen. Danach muss die Grub Konfigurationsdatei (/boot/grub/grub.cfg) neu „kompiliert“ werden:
|
1 |
sudo grub-mkconfig -o /boot/grub/grub.cfg |
Nach einem abschließenden Neustart sollte der Login nun ebenfalls in eine Wayland Session möglich sein. Überprüft werden kann das mit der Variable $XDG_SESSION_TYPE.
